Job description, work day and responsibilities

In collaboration with R/CHMT’s and MERL team, She/he will design, develop, and disseminate (FP/MNCH/RH/Biodiversity conservation) tools and IEC materials with focus on gender and youths. She/he will provide supports and collaboration to the government officials, project stakeholders and other implementing partners (TNC, Consortium partners and others). Furthermore, represents the program in all FP/MNCH/SRHR/Biodiversity conservation related trainings, workshops, and technical working groups avenues. Furthermore, She/he will support the link between the communities and health facilities in the implementation of community-based activities including FP/MNCH and Biodiversity conservation outreach services.

She/he will work on a full-time basis, reporting to the Senior Portfolio Technical Advisor – PHE Programs, and be based in Kigoma with travel throughout the TKH landscape.
